Among eight human bladder cancer cell lines we examined, only T24 cells were resistant to the growth inhibition effect of genistein, an isoflavone and potent anticancer drug.
Since the T24 cell line was the only cell line known to overexpress oncogenic H-Ras val 12 , we investigated the role of H-Ras val 12 in mediating drug resistance. Herein, we demonstrate that the phenotype of T24 cells could be dramatically reversed and became relatively susceptible to growth inhibition by genistein if the synthesis of H-Ras val 12 or its downstream effector c-Fos had been suppressed.
These results suggest that the signal mediated by H-Ras val 12 is predominantly responsible for the resistance of the cells to the anticancer drug genistein. Keywords: H-Ras, bladder transitional cell carcinoma, genistein, microarray profiling gene expression pattern, drug resistance.

Mutational activation of the H-ras oncogene was first reported Reddy et al , ; Tabin et al , in human T24 TCC cell line that played an essential role in urothelial carcinogenesis. Therefore, oncogenic activation of H-Ras is an important tumorigenic factor for bladder tumours. High soybean food consumption, which provides ingestion of a substantial amount of genistein, has been suggested to contribute to the relatively low rates of many cancers in Asian countries Lee et al , ; Messina et al , Genistein, an isoflavone with a structure similar to oestrogen a phyto-oestrogen , possesses potent inhibitory activities against growth factor-associated tyrosine protein kinases Akiyama et al , and DNA topoisomerase II Markovits et al , It is also an antioxidant Naim et al , with the capability of suppressing angiogenesis and endothelial cell proliferation in vitro Fotsis et al , Genistein is a compound with a variety of potential properties that mainly inhibit tumour growth in vitro and in vivo.
